Sea Scouts 10-14 year-olds, Thursdays 1900-2100 |
At Sea Scouts real emphasis is placed on the importance of teamwork from the outset and the aim of the Troop is to develop Sea Scouts' lives physically, culturally and spiritually whilst having a lot of fun at the same time! The Troop participate in a number of regional competitions such as night hikes and regattas. The most important events on our water sports calendar are the Blashford Sailing Regatta and the Eling Canoeing Regatta. |
Winter activities typically include a little drill, an outdoor wide game and an indoor game such as 'Spotlight'. This is supplemented with work towards the Scout Proficiency Badge scheme. During the summer, the troop does sailing and kayaking, working towards RYA and BCU certificates. Subscriptions cost £2.50 per week, payable in advance at the beginning of each term. |
